Product Description
Italian Croissants offer a unique twist on the classic French pastry, known for their lighter, slightly sweeter dough. Often called cornetti, they are made with enriched dough, incorporating eggs and sometimes milk for a tender crumb. Italian croissants come in a variety of fillings, such as apricot jam, pastry cream, chocolate, or honey, and are usually dusted with powdered sugar. Unlike their French counterparts, they are less buttery and more bread-like, making them perfect for pairing with coffee or cappuccino. Whether plain or filled, Italian croissants are a beloved part of the country's traditional breakfast culture.
